Job Title: Residential Construction Land Acquisition Manager

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Land Acquisition Manager to join our team at GPAC. As a key member of our organization, you will be responsible for acquiring undeveloped land or finished lots for development, working closely with property owners, brokers, land developers, city officials, and other stakeholders to secure land.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Coordinate and secure land acquisition leads
  • Perform title and municipal research, and initial "cold call" inquiry for potential land leads
  • Provide initial meetings with sellers and/or their representatives
  • Prepare letters of intent and negotiate purchase contracts with sellers
  • Underwrite and analyze the financial aspects of each development opportunity
  • Maintain close relationships with land developers, brokers, and land owners
  • Communicate regularly with city officials

Requirements:

  • 3+ years of experience in land acquisition or a related field
  • Bachelor's degree in engineering, finance, real estate, or a related field
  • Strong written and oral communication skills
  • Ability to multi-task and attention to detail
